Substantively hermetically sealing container
A container that seals in a volume of material is provided. The container may be routinely opened, closed and material may be removed or added. A removable plate and a base define a maximum volume available for material when the container is sealed. A screen may be disposed between the plate and the base. The screen may optionally be comprised within the base, adhered to the base, or removable from the base. Features for enabling manipulation of the plate and/or screen are optionally provided.
Cap assembly
The present application is directed to cap assemblies and particularly, cap assembly for closing an opening in a vessel, the cap assembly including a stopper including an polymer body adapted to fit an opening of a vessel, the stopper also including a tubular portion which defines an internal passageway extending through the polymer body; and a rigid cap attached to and integral with the stopper, wherein the cap is adapted to engage the vessel and provide a sealing force between the stopper and the vessel.
Vacuum wine bottle stopper and cap, and method of use
A wine bottle stopper is provided including a vacuum stopper and a removable decorative cap. The vacuum stopper includes a central conduit extends longitudinally through the vacuum stopper, and a one-way valve is located within the central conduit. The vacuum stopper includes an upper portion which extends exterior to the wine bottle and a bottom shaft sized for insertion into a wine bottle's opening. The vacuum stopper also has a release valve connected to the one-way valve. Meanwhile, the decorative cap has a sidewall and a top wall forming a central cavity sized to engage and cover the vacuum stopper's upper portion. The central cavity's top wall has a center recess sized and positioned to receive the vacuum stopper's release button. Preferably, the decorative cap includes a decorative feature providing a pleasing appearance.

SEALING SYSTEMS
The embodiments of the present disclosure provide a stopper comprising a plug and a pierceable membrane, the plug including a cavity between a pierceable membrane and a lower opening. The pierceable membrane and the cavity can form a tortuous path that reduces interactions between the contents of the container and the ambient environment. The cavity can be bounded by a plastic insert disposed within the plug. The plastic insert can include insert walls, the lower opening, and an insert flange. The pierceable membrane can be bonded to an upper surface of the insert flange.

SAFETY CLOSING DEVICE
Described herein is a closing device including a closing element, a sealing element and a closing cap. The closing element is connectable at least form-fitted or force-fitted with a neck of a container. The closing device can be brought in a closed state, in which the closing cap closes output opening, and can be brought in an opened state, in which the output opening is released.
